Damage Deposit - A deposit will be paid by the tenant, prior to the commencement of the tenancy, equivalent to five weeks rent and it will be returned at the end of the tenancy providing there is no damage, the Inventory is correct and there are no rent arrears. The deposit will be held by the Deposit Protection Service (a custodial service scheme in accordance with the Tenancy Deposit Legislation) and returned to you as per the Tenancy Agreement.
Holding Deposit - Grisdales takes a Holding Deposit for from a tenant to reserve a property. This is one week‘s rent and for this property will be £138.00
This Holding Deposit will be held for up to 15 days (what is known as Deadline for Agreement). From taking the Holding Deposit, the Tenancy Agreement must be entered into (signed by both parties and dated) before the Deadline for Agreement. However, Grisdales can agree with the tenant in writing that a different date (for example, an extension) is to be the Deadline for Agreement. Please make your own enquiries as to when the Holding Deposit can be repaid to you and when it can be retained by Grisdales.
Should the tenancy commence, unless the tenant advises otherwise in writing, it is agreed that the amount of the Holding Deposit will be deducted from the first payment of rent.

Insurance - You are required to have sufficient means to cover your liability for the Landlords fixtures and fittings as set out in the Tenancy Agreement. Sufficient means includes a sum of money available to put right any damage, or alternatively you could purchase a suitable insurance policy to cover this liability.
The Landlords insurance policy does not cover your possessions within the property. You are advised to consider the need for Tenants Insurance, which usually includes cover for your own possessions and accidental damage to the Landlords items.
The Landlord will not be responsible for any damage caused to your belongings unless it is caused by an act or omission by the Landlord or Agent, which invalidates any insurance you do have.
It is recommended that you hold adequate insurance to protect against accidental damage caused by the Tenant to the Landlords Fixtures and Fittings at the premises as described in the Inventory. You should also consider insuring your own possessions. Please speak to Grisdales for further information.
